06:44
1,0×
00:00/06:44
76 тыс смотрели · 3 года назад
11 месяцев назад
Ассемблер. Команды битового сдвига
Эта статья поможет вам лучше понять не только как работают команды сдвига, но и то, как компьютер оперирует с цифрами и символами. Языки высокого уровня вам такого понимания не дадут. Команды сдвига бывают циклическими, логическими и арифметическими. Циклические сдвиги влияют на значения флагов OF и CF, остальные на значения флагов OF, SF, PF, CF, ZF. Циклические команды ROL и ROR сдвигают биты влево и вправо соответственно при этом выдвигаемые биты за пределы размера регистра или переменной в памяти, заносятся в освобождающиеся биты...
1 год назад
Ассемблер. Регистры
Регистры - это маленькие ячейки памяти расположенные непосредственно на самом процессоре компьютера, поэтому, скорость обращения к ним очень высока и почти равна тактовой частоте процессора. То есть, если тактовая частота вашего процессора равна 3000 Гц, то скорость выполнения операций будет больше 2500 в секунду, именно поэтому ассемблер был и будет самым быстрым языком программирования. В этой статье мы будем рассматривать 16-ти битный ассемблер архитектуры 8086 на которой работают DOS-овские программы...